Who is Labat?
Labat (otherwise known as Alex Labat or SNLabat) is an Internet Personality and Twitch Partner. A husband and father, he’s also the SEO Director for Burning Stick Creative. He’s also authored an autobiographical book, written and produced original music albums, hosts a podcast and more. Labat is also an Associated Press award winning former news presenter during his tenure at KATC TV 3, the ABC News affiliate in Lafayette, Louisiana.
Internet Personality
Labat became a Twitch Partner on July 22nd, 2022. Labat began streaming on Twitch on June 5, 2020. Labat’s first stream was Super Mario 64 and he would play a variety of different games until being accepted into the whitelisted NoPixel roleplay server on April 9, 2021. It was on April 9, 2021 that Labat introduced the character of Maximilian Delicious (Mr. Delicious) and his streams have mainly focused on roleplaying this FiveM modded Grand Theft Auto V roleplay server while still engaging with his chat and community with interactive games enabled through services like Crowd Control.

Podcast Host
Launched in 2016, Labat is a self-titled podcast that was once called ALEXplains It All. Hosted by Labat and SubtlePlays, the podcast touches on a wide variety of topics, ranging from pop culture to comic books. The podcast went on hiatus at the end of 2016 but is expected to return.

News Presenter (2010s)
Labat began working at KATC TV 3, the ABC News affiliate in Lafayette, Louisiana in May of 2011. He would work his way from behind-the-scenes in the production department, where he operated the studio cameras and on-air graphics, to in front of the camera as a multimedia journalist, news reporter, news producer and news presenter. Labat went on to win numerous awards for his work with KATC, but most notably he was awarded the “Reporter of the Year” award by the Associated Press.
Education
Labat graduated from the University of Louisiana at Lafayette in December of 2012 with a Bachelor of Arts in Mass Communication with a Concentration in Broadcasting and a Minor in English.
